Australia, renowned for its stunning coastlines and vibrant culture, offers a plethora of luxury hotels that epitomize premium coastal living. One such gem is the Qualia Resort on Hamilton Island, nestled in the heart of the Whitsundays. This exclusive resort is designed to provide an unparalleled experience, with its private pavilions offering breathtaking views of the Coral Sea. Guests can indulge in world-class amenities, including a serene spa, fine dining options, and direct access to pristine beaches. The resort’s commitment to sustainability and its integration with the natural environment further enhance its appeal, making it a perfect retreat for those seeking both luxury and tranquility.

Moving south to the picturesque shores of Byron Bay, the Cape Byron Lighthouse offers a unique blend of history and luxury. The nearby Elements of Byron Resort & Spa is a standout destination, featuring eco-friendly villas that seamlessly blend with the surrounding landscape. Guests can enjoy the resort’s infinity pool, which overlooks the ocean, or take a leisurely stroll along the beach. The on-site restaurant serves locally sourced cuisine, allowing visitors to savor the flavors of the region while enjoying stunning sunset views. The combination of natural beauty and luxurious accommodations makes this resort a must-visit for discerning travelers.

Continuing along the coast, the Gold Coast is home to the Palazzo Versace, a hotel that exudes opulence and sophistication. This iconic establishment, designed in collaboration with the renowned fashion house, features lavish interiors adorned with Versace’s signature style. Guests can unwind in the expansive lagoon pool or indulge in a treatment at the luxurious spa. The hotel’s dining options are equally impressive, with several restaurants offering gourmet cuisine that showcases the best of Australian produce. The Palazzo Versace not only provides a luxurious stay but also serves as a gateway to the vibrant nightlife and stunning beaches of the Gold Coast.

Further down the coast, the Southern Ocean Lodge on Kangaroo Island presents a unique opportunity to experience luxury in a remote and unspoiled setting. Perched on a cliff overlooking the ocean, this lodge offers a blend of modern design and natural beauty. Each suite features floor-to-ceiling windows that provide panoramic views of the rugged coastline. Guests can partake in guided tours to explore the island’s diverse wildlife and pristine landscapes, making it an ideal destination for nature enthusiasts. The lodge’s commitment to sustainability and local cuisine enhances the overall experience, allowing visitors to connect with the environment while enjoying the finest comforts.

In the vibrant city of Sydney, the Park Hyatt Sydney stands out as a premier luxury hotel with an enviable location on the edge of Sydney Harbour. With its contemporary design and stunning views of the Sydney Opera House and Harbour Bridge, this hotel offers an urban oasis for travelers. Guests can relax in the rooftop pool or indulge in a treatment at the spa, all while enjoying the vibrant atmosphere of the city. The hotel’s dining options, including the acclaimed restaurant, provide a culinary journey that highlights the best of Australian flavors, making it a perfect choice for those seeking both luxury and cultural immersion.

Lastly, the Saffire Freycinet in Tasmania offers a unique coastal experience that combines luxury with breathtaking natural beauty. Located near the stunning Freycinet National Park, this hotel features spacious suites with spectacular views of the Hazards Mountains and the surrounding coastline. Guests can enjoy gourmet dining that emphasizes local ingredients, as well as a range of activities such as wine tasting and guided hikes. The Saffire Freycinet not only provides a luxurious escape but also allows visitors to immerse themselves in the stunning landscapes and rich biodiversity of Tasmania, making it a truly unforgettable destination.

What are the top luxury hotels in Australia with coastal views?

Some of the top luxury hotels include the Qualia Resort in Hamilton Island, the Saffire Freycinet in Tasmania, and the One&Only Hayman Island. Each offers stunning coastal views and exceptional amenities.

What amenities can I expect at luxury coastal hotels in Australia?

Luxury coastal hotels typically offer high-end amenities such as private beaches, infinity pools, gourmet dining, spa services, and personalized concierge services. Many also provide water sports and guided tours of the surrounding natural beauty.

Are there any eco-friendly luxury hotels in Australia?

Yes, several luxury hotels in Australia prioritize sustainability, such as the Eco Beach Resort in Broome and the Saffire Freycinet. These hotels incorporate eco-friendly practices while providing a premium experience.

What is the best time to visit luxury coastal hotels in Australia?

The best time to visit is generally during the Australian spring (September to November) and autumn (March to May) when the weather is mild and pleasant. Summer can be hot, while winter may be cooler in some regions.

Do luxury hotels in Australia offer family-friendly options?

Many luxury hotels cater to families with amenities such as kids’ clubs, family suites, and activities for all ages. Properties like the Sheraton Grand Mirage Resort in Gold Coast provide a range of family-oriented services.
